2. Excalibur
Are you looking for a cheap family-friendly hotel on the Las Vegas Strip? Check out Excalibur Hotel & Casino!
Located on the South Strip, this medieval-themed hotel is perfect for families. With reasonably priced rooms and plenty of kid-friendly activities, it’s an excellent option for those who want to save money without sacrificing quality.
The Excalibur offers a variety of amenities that make it stand out from other hotels in the area. The Fun Dungeon is an arcade experience that your kids will love.
There are also several restaurants, bars, and a great pool, and spa.
The rooms at Excalibur are comfortable and affordable, making it one of the best cheap hotels in Las Vegas. You can choose from standard rooms or suites depending on your needs.
All rooms have basic amenities such as air conditioning, flat-screen TVs, and free WiFi access.
Overall, we rate Excalibur 3.5/5 stars for its affordability and family-friendly atmosphere.

4. Flamingo
If you’re looking for an affordable hotel on the Las Vegas Strip, look no further than Flamingo Las Vegas Hotel & Casino.
Located in the heart of The Strip, this classic Vegas-style hotel offers everything you need for a great stay.
The resort features newly renovated rooms with a mix of classic Vegas style and modern amenities.
You can also enjoy a state-of-the-art pool with waterfalls, a water slide, and an adults-only area. Plus, you’ll find pink Chilean flamingos, Mandarin ducks, and koi fish in its lush gardens.
Flamingo Las Vegas is also home to some of the best entertainment in town. Catch Piff The Magic Dragon, regarded as one of the best magic shows in Las Vegas, or participate in exciting gaming action at the casino.
There are plenty of restaurants to choose from, including Jimmy Buffett’s Margaritaville and Carlos’n Charlie’s Las Vegas.
We give Flamingo Las Vegas Hotel & Casino 4 out of 5 stars for its affordability compared to other cheap hotels on The Strip and its range of amenities and features.

6. New York New York
If you’re visiting Las Vegas during the week, you need to check out New York New York Hotel & Casino on the South Strip.
This hotel is more expensive than other cheap Las Vegas hotels, but often you can find a midweek deal that makes it worth every penny.
The hotel features a state-of-the-art casino, an adrenaline-pumping roller coaster, and a 150-foot replica of the Statue of Liberty.
It offers many entertainment options, including Mad Apple by Cirque du Soleil. Plus, there are plenty of dining options available to choose from.
The rooms at New York New York are spacious and comfortable, with all the modern amenities you need for your stay.
The staff is friendly and helpful and will ensure your stay is as enjoyable as possible.
We rate this hotel 4.5 out of 5 stars for its excellent amenities and features.

9. Circus Circus
Circus Circus is the perfect choice for families with young kids if you’re looking for a cheap hotel on The Strip in Las Vegas.
Located on the North Strip, this iconic hotel offers plenty of amenities and features that make it stand out from other cheap Las Vegas hotels.
The rooms are plain and comfortable. But the real selling point is the incredible pool with multiple waterslides and splash pads for the kids. Plus, they’ll love the Adventuredome, an indoor theme park with a giant roller coaster and other rides.
Circus Circus also offers plenty of dining options, mostly fast-food and casual dining.
There’s also a casino with table games and slots. Plus, it’s close to Resorts World and the Las Vegas Convention Center.
Overall, we rate Circus Circus 2/5 stars because it’s one of the cheapest hotels on The Strip in Las Vegas. It has all the amenities you need for a family vacation without breaking the bank.
